How much horsepower does a 1987 Chevy Cavalier Z24 have?

The 1987 Chevy Cavalier Z24 was a sporty version of the popular compact car, and it packed a decent amount of power under the hood. According to the available information, the 1987 Cavalier Z24 had a horsepower rating of 130.


Detailed Specifications of the 1987 Chevy Cavalier Z24


The 1987 Chevy Cavalier Z24 was powered by a 2.8-liter V6 engine, which was the top-of-the-line engine option for the Cavalier lineup that year. This engine was capable of producing 130 horsepower at 5,200 rpm and 155 lb-ft of torque at 4,000 rpm.


The Cavalier Z24 was available with either a 5-speed manual transmission or a 3-speed automatic transmission. The manual transmission version was the more performance-oriented option, as it allowed the driver to better utilize the engine's power and torque.

How much horsepower does a C90 engine have?


between 90 and 100 horsepower
The Continental C90 and O-200 are a family of air-cooled, horizontally opposed, four-cylinder, direct-drive aircraft engines of 201 in3 (3.29 L) displacement, producing between 90 and 100 horsepower (67 and 75 kW).



What year 454 has the most horsepower?


The 1970 versions of the Chevrolet 454 were the most powerful, with the LS5 putting out around 360 horsepower and the LS6 delivering about 450 horses. The LS6 was phased out after 1971, and the LS5's power had dwindled to about 245 horsepower by 1973 thanks to stricter emissions control.



How much horsepower does a 1987 Z24 have?


130 horsepower
Notes: Chevrolet Cavalier Z24...has a new higher-horsepower V6 engine and a 5-speed manual transmission that makes the hot one even hotter for 1987. The new "Generaiton II" 2.8 liter V6 now delivers 130 horsepower, up from 120 in '86.

What is the Z24 package?


For 1986, the Z24 package was added as on option for the coupe and hatchback models. It featured digital gauges, sport wheels, a ground effects kit, and a specific front fascia.



How much horsepower does a 1987 Chevy 454 have?


255 hp
L19. General Motors introduced EFI in 1987, which was found on GM C1500 SS, C/K2500, and C/K3500 trucks. The 454 EFI version was rated from 230 hp (172 kW) to 255 hp (190 kW) and from 385 lb⋅ft (522 N⋅m) to 405 lb⋅ft (549 N⋅m) of torque.



How much horsepower does a 1986 Cavalier Z24 have?


120 horses
The Z24 debuted for the 1986 model year, and it came with a fuel-injected 2.8-liter V6 making 120 horses plus some mean-looking body panels and trim bits.
